Back to jobs
Google

Senior Software Engineer, AI Core Capabilities

Posted 3 days ago

Job Description

  • Collaborate closely with DeepMind, CoreML, and Research to adapt and implement the Gemini Nano model for mobile user applications.
  • Build simple, solid, and impactful developer-facing ML Kit and AICore APIs to empower both first-party and third-party app developers to create innovative user experiences with GenAI technologies in Android applications.
  • Optimize the on-device inference latency and resource consumption for various Gemini Nano versions (V1, V2, V3, V4, etc.), ensuring they are optimally integrated into the mobile environment across the Android ecosystem.
  • Work closely with product teams to innovate and implement novel user experiences and agentic workflows, leveraging techniques like Functional Calling, Retrieval-Augmented Generation (RAG), constraint decoding, gemma embedding, multi-modal processing, traditional machine learning models, LoRAs, and targeted Large Language Model (LLM) fine-tuning.
Senior Software Engineer, AI Core Capabilities at Google | Renata